Yeah, I searched. It's 24wHP (~28 flywheel HP) for an RB exhaust including the header. But I read the header makes an annoying raspy noise and probably only adds 1HP. Plus it's expensive.
In the future we both should just search. I don't know anything about corksport but RB seems to be the most popular. Bonez is nice too, I hear. I'd be careful about where you get the cat, b/c '7s tend to overheat them. Bonez and RB cats should work. I just added up the cost of a full exhaust from www.rx7.com (w/ Bonez cats) and it's $750 brand new. But you/I could probably get the $400 cat-back used and save some money. Don't get a used cat, though. Cats have a limited lifespan.
